Output ef62fd5dc1776b529668623addb385d38dc2bf545954c096ef490f27f97d1f87:1

value
1001060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e652e5ef99c08e433d9275f733ad6e907ab44e OP_EQUAL
address
34xqVSKsCbYSGdvqhCGtYjQm6LiD99nre9
transaction
ef62fd5dc1776b529668623addb385d38dc2bf545954c096ef490f27f97d1f87
spent
true